Best Bread Machine Buns

By

Olive oil and egg give these bread machine buns a rich texture and flavor. Leftovers (if there are any) will keep for up to a week in a plastic bag.

Ingredients

  • 1 1/4 cups milk
  • 1/4 to 1/3 cup olive oil
  • 1/4 cup white sugar
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 egg, lightly beaten
  • 3 3/4 cups bread flour
  • 1 tablespoon fast rising yeast or 1 tablespoon bread machine yeast

Preparation

Step 1

Place the ingredients in bread machine pan in the following order: milk, oil, sugar, salt, beaten egg, and flour.

Make a little well in the flour and add the yeast.

For rolls, select Dough Setting and press start.

Shape dough into rolls when cycle is completed and place dough rounds about 1 inch apart on a lightly floured cookie sheet.

Cover and let rise about 45 minutes in warm draft free area. A slightly warmed oven with the light bulb on works well.

When doubled in size, uncover and bake at 350°F for 15 to 17 minutes or until golden brown.

Cool on cooling rack for 20 minutes. Can be stored in plastic bag for up to 1 week.
